The motion of trees in the wind: a data synthesis [PDF]

open access: yesBiogeosciences, 2021
Interactions between wind and trees control energy exchanges between the atmosphere and forest canopies. This energy exchange can lead to the widespread damage of trees, and wind is a key disturbance agent in many of the world's forests.

Co-occurrence patterns of tree-related microhabitats: A method to simplify routine monitoring

open access: yesEcological Indicators, 2021
A Tree-related Microhabitat (TreM) is a distinct, well-delineated morphological singularity occurring on living or standing dead trees, which constitutes a crucial substrate or life site for various species.
